Carmine Tramunti took over the Lucchese crime family following the death of the organization's boss, Thomas Lucchese, in 1967. Tramunti and Anthony "Tony Ducks" Corrallo were rivals to ascend to the top spot of the New York City syndicate. Tramunti later made a name for himself with investments in nightclubs, dice games and various rackets. The most infamous bars in which he had a stake were the Pussycat and Bachelor's III, both in Manhattan. The latter was especially well-known because New York Jets football player Joe Namath was a prominent investor.
